Kiyan Williams is among the 69 artists and 2 collectives participating in the Whitney Biennial 2024: Even Better Than the Real Thing, the 81st edition of the Whitney Museum’s celebrated survey of contemporary American art. Co-organized by curators Chrissie Iles and Meg Onli, the Biennial interrogates the concept of "the real," reflecting on societal shifts shaped by artificial intelligence, fluid notions of identity, and critical conversations about land and embodiment.

This thematic exhibition unfolds as a “dissonant chorus,” exploring the interplay between history, identity, and the precarity of the present moment. Featuring works across various media and disciplines, the Biennial extends into robust film and performance programs. Williams’ participation contributes to this critical dialogue, underscoring their innovative approach to examining identity and the materiality of the world.
